GPT-5.1 vs Qwen-Flash at a glance

Specs and pricing side by side, from the Appaca AI models directory.

Spec GPT-5.1 Qwen-Flash
Provider OpenAI Alibaba Cloud
Model type Text Text
Context window 400K tokens 1M tokens
Input price $1.25 / 1M tokens $0.022 / 1M tokens
Output price $10 / 1M tokens $0.216 / 1M tokens
Status Current Current
Key differences

How GPT-5.1 and Qwen-Flash differ

What the numbers mean in practice when choosing between GPT-5.1 and Qwen-Flash.

  • Qwen-Flash is 98% cheaper on input tokens ($0.022 vs $1.25 per million), which adds up quickly in document-heavy workloads.

  • Qwen-Flash is 98% cheaper on output tokens ($0.216 vs $10 per million) - the bigger factor for tools that generate long documents.

  • Qwen-Flash's 1M tokens context window is roughly 2.5x larger than GPT-5.1's 400K tokens, so it can work across bigger codebases, contracts, or archives in one pass.

Strengths side by side

Where each model shines, according to benchmarks and provider positioning.

GPT-5.1

1. Configurable Reasoning for Agentic Tasks

  • Built to excel in autonomous or semi-autonomous coding workflows, with adjustable reasoning effort for planning, refactoring and debugging.

2. Fast Multi-Modal Input with Large Output

  • Accepts both text and image inputs while producing text outputs.
  • Offers up to 128 k output tokens, allowing long responses and code generation across multiple files.

3. Large Context & Knowledge Cut-Off

  • 400 k token context window supports processing large codebases or documents.
  • Knowledge cut-off of Sep 30 2024 ensures familiarity with recent tools and frameworks.

4. Reasoning Token Support

  • Provides explicit support for reasoning tokens, enabling developers to fine-tune the balance between reasoning depth and speed.

Qwen-Flash

1. Ultra-fast, ultra-cheap

  • Designed for mass-scale workloads.
  • Excellent for rewriting, extraction, classification.

2. Limited reasoning but great utility

  • High throughput, low latency.

3. Optional thinking mode

  • Adds chain-of-thought when needed.

4. Supports context cache & batch calls

  • Very cost-effective system design.

Which has the larger context window, GPT-5.1 or Qwen-Flash?

Qwen-Flash has the larger context window at 1M tokens, compared to 400K tokens for GPT-5.1. A larger window means the model can consider more text at once - useful for long contracts, codebases, or months of records.
